Western Aero Repair, Inc. Certified as a Woman Business Enterprise
DENVER, Nov. 1, 2016 -- Western Aero Repair, Inc., a leading, award-winning and FAA/EASA-certified provider of repair, maintenance and restoration of military, commercial and cargo aircraft, has been certified as a business owned and controlled by a woman by the National Women Business Owners Corporation (NWBOC), the first national certifier of women business enterprises. Over 700 public and private sector individuals participated in establishing the standards and procedures of this rigid certification review. The goal of the certification program is to streamline the certification process and increase the ability of women business owners to compete for contracts at a national level.

NWBOC, a national 501(c)3 not-for-profit corporation, was created in response to needs identified by the Procurement Special Interest Group of the National Association of Women Business Owners. The study revealed that the public and private sector had not received nor recognized the benefits of contracting with women suppliers. This has prevented purchasers from obtaining the best value in their procurement and it has limited women business owners from penetrating these markets, which has stymied their growth. NWBOC seeks to provide more corporations with the opportunity to better their procurement practices and to women suppliers the opportunity to compete. NWBOC provides the following certifications: WBE (Woman Business Enterprise), WOSB and EDWOSB for the 8m federal contracting program (approved third party certifier for the U.S. Small Business Administration) and VBE/VWBE for male and female veteran owned companies. About Western Aero Repair, Inc.
Founded in 2002, Western Aero Repair, Inc. is part of the Western Aero portfolio of companies—Western Aero Services, Western Aero Repair and American Jet Industries—where leading military, commercial and cargo aviation companies turn to for a 360-degree, concierge-minded approach to servicing their MRO needs. Located just minutes from downtown Denver, the company is a proud, six-time FAA Diamond Award recipient. Its 110,000 sq. ft. FAA/EASA-approved airframe repair facility focuses on aircraft repair, maintenance and restoration, providing large contract and legacy tooling capabilities, as well as a state-of-the-art paint booth and blast booth. The company's technicians employ the most current knowledge in airframe repair technology, coupled with the care and dedication of a skilled team of craftsmen.
